The adopted Plan currently recommends Single Family for the site. The property does directly abut an area shown as commercial. 0-1, Quiet Office district, is an appropriate zoning category to accommodate low -intensity uses which are proposed to be located within established areas of the city and in close proximity to residential uses. The property does fall within the larger "East of I-30" area. This area generally is defined as that area bounded by the river, I-30, Roosevelt Road and the airport. The Land Use Plan for this area, which includes the I-30 and East Little Rock Planning Districts, will be reviewed in conjunction with the anticipated Presidential Library Park and Heifer Project developments. It is anticipated that detailed design standards will be developed for the area north of East 9t' Street. At this time staff does not believe it is necessary to amend the Land Use Plan to accommodate this proposed, two -lot, 0-1 rezoning. The site lies at the eastern fringe of the area covered by the Downtown Neighborhoods Action Plan which was adopted on March 16, 1999. Any Land Use Plan or zoning changes proposed by the Plan were located in an area west of I-30, south of I-630. The Plan focused very little on this area east of I-30. Two objectives of the Plan were to "increase cooperation between zoning officials and developers to renovate existing properties" and to "increase small business development". This proposal appears to meet the intent of those objectives. WA June 14, 2001 ITEM NO.: A, (Cont.) FILE NO.: Z-7014 STAFF ANALYSIS The request before the Commission is to rezone these two lots from "R-4" Two -Family Residential to "0-1" Quiet Office. The northern lot (921 East 9t' Street) contains a vacant, one-story, brick and frame residential structure and a detached, brick and frame garage. The abutting lot to the south (904 East Welch) is vacant. The applicant proposes to remodel the residential structure for use as an attorney's office and to develop some parking on the vacant lot. The property was located in the path of the January 1999 tornado. A second dwelling that was located on the site was destroyed by the storm. Numerous other structures in the area were either heavily damaged or destroyed, leaving vacant lots. The property is located on the northern edge of a small residential neighborhood, in an area of mixed zoning and uses. The C-3 zoned property adjacent to the west is occupied by a drug store. Vacant lots and single family and duplex dwellings are located on the R-4 zoned properties to the south and east. Multifamily dwellings are located on the C-3, R-4 and R-5 zoned properties across 9t' Street, to the north. Interstate 30 is located 1 1-� blocks to the west and a large area of industrial uses and zoning begins two blocks to the east. The 0-1 Quiet Office district is established in order to provide for orderly conversion of older structures no longer useful, serviceable or desirable in their present uses to office use. The area standards provided in the 0-1 Quiet Office district anticipate that office uses will be located in established areas of the city and in close proximity to apartments and other residential uses. Height, area and off-street parking regulations are designed to assure that office uses will be compatible with adjacent residential districts. 0-1 has a very limited list of permitted uses. Staff believes the proposed 0-1 zoning is compatible with uses and zoning in the area. Staff does not believe a land use plan amendment is necessary at this time. STAFF RECOMMENDATION Staff recommends approval of the requested 0-1 zoning. 3 June 14, 2001 ITEM NO.: A, (Cont.
